A judge has several key roles, including interpreting laws and assessing evidence, controlling the proceedings in a courtroom, and serving as a pillar of the justice system. Judges must uphold the highest standards of integrity both professionally and personally. They should be knowledgeable of the law, conduct thorough legal research, and issue decisions that are clear, sound, fair, and open-minded. Important personal qualities for a judge include integrity, honesty, courtesy, empathy, patience, knowledge, and a sense of fair play.
